On a day of remembrance and celebration at Fenway Park as the Red Sox played at home for the first time since the Boston Marathon bombings, a Boston tradition of singing 'Sweet Caroline' took a special turn on Saturday. Neil Diamond was at Fenway Park in person to sing his song in the eighth inning.
Neil Diamond sings ‘Sweet Caroline’ at Fenway Park
“What an honor it is to be here today,” Diamond told the Boston crowd before beginning the song at Fenway Park on Saturday.
